Massena LAB is pleased to announce the UNIMATIC U4S-BRZ-SI, a three-way collaboration between Italian watchmakers UNIMATIC; British designer, artist, and master engraver King Nerd; and Massena LAB.

The U4S-BRZ-SI commemorates the story of William Tell, the Swiss folk hero thought to be the originator of the Swiss Confederation.

The U4S-BRZ-SI, or “Swiss Tell”, features a bronze dial covered by a layer of black galvanic coating. When engraved by King Nerd, the black coating is etched away to reveal the gold tones of the original bronze underneath.

The dial depicts three elements of the William Tell folk legend. At the center of the dial, the apple represents not only the literal fruit from the Tell story, but also The Big Apple — New York City — home to both Massena LAB and the Swiss Institute. The arrows, piercing the apple, function as the dial’s hour marks while also symbolizing precision, forward-movement, and progress. The bounds of ribbon, the loose blindfold of Tell’s rescued son, is a symbol of freedom, liberation, and the opposite of blindness: vision, wisdom, and knowledge.

The story of the U4S-BRZ-SI, however, does not end with its dial—the heart of any watch is its movement, and the watch is powered by a Swiss-made caliber. Of course, this is only fitting for a watch conceived to celebrate Swiss history and culture.

The U4S-BRZ-SI is a pièce unique, conceived and created for the Swiss Institutes’ “Time for Art” auction. The watch was not commercialized or reproduced.
